1952 M38. I just added an Satrn Overdrive. I have put 1 quart and 20 ounces of gear lube after draining and installing the OD, and the lube is still not overflowing out of the fill access, which I thought was how you were supposed to know it was full. What am I doing wrong? Is this normal?

There is a hole between the tranny and transfer that lets the fluid transfer. It is located near the top of the divide on the right side. You have to account for this internal transfer activity. Review your service manual carefully.
